Downpipes are very common in older buildings. Also known as a waterspout, it’s a pipe that drains water from your guttering system to a drain in the ground. If water begins backing up into the gutter, the downpipe is likely blocked. Overflowing rainfall is also a telltale sign the downpipe requires gutter maintenance to unblock it.

Spotting downpipe blockages fast is crucial. When water is allowed to stand in downpipes, during spells of cold weather it can freeze and cause the pipe to split. If this happens, it’s very expensive to repair. This is why regular gutter health checks are a smart investment in the long-term.
